The making

Paper is developed by creative labs within Facebook and it was designed by Mike Matas who designed the first iPhone’s interface. Paper was initially conceived to give the Facebook a better look overall. Normal newsfeed  in Facebook was abandoned in favor of a multifaceted newsfeed. This newsfeed is a fresh and creative looking in every way. Every other section is a mix of popular and recent newsfeed that is edited and controlled by a powerful team dedicated to it. You will find posts from The Times, New York Post and many other popular places. Curating your newsfeed is as good as it gets with you being able to demote your friends, highlight popular posts in the form of a trending section and with a quick click and drag, you can arrange so that the headlines show first.
